Statement from American Atheists President About Las Vegas Shooting

Cranford, NJ—After the mass shooting in Las Vegas that claimed the lives of more than 50 people and injured hundreds, American Atheists president David Silverman made the following statement:

My heart breaks for the victims of this horrendous act of violence and for their families and loved ones. I offer my deepest condolences and support to everyone affected by this devastating tragedy. Our community mourns with you and stands ready to support you as you begin the process of recovery from this senseless act.

To community leaders and organizers, I urge you to ensure that all members of the community are included in the grieving and the response to Sunday’s events. When organizing remembrances, vigils, and memorials, please remember that the atheists and other non-believers in your community are mourning too. While some find comfort in words about “God’s plan” or that victims are “with God,” for others, these words will—at best—ring hollow and—at worst—deepen their grief.

We simply ask that you include your entire community in your response. Reach out to atheist and humanist chaplains or leaders for assistance. Include representatives from as many faith traditions as possible, but I implore you, do not exclude the quarter of Americans who are part of no religion.
